Skid Steer Property Clearing Jobs: Effectiveness & Methods
Utilizing a Bobcat for terrain removal significantly boosts productivity compared to conventional approaches. Several processes can enhance your results. First, use a forestry mulcher attachment to reduce undergrowth and bushes. For substantial timber, a tree shear is typically required. Careful planning and secure operating are vital for a favorable result and to minimize injury to nearby vegetation. Finally, a scoop can be employed to move the removed vegetation for recycling.
How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ost?
Figuring out the cost of land preparation can be tricky , as several factors influence the overall amount . Generally, you might see costs ranging from $1 to $5 per yard foot, but this is merely a rough calculation . The type of vegetation – is it dense with trees, brush, or just light debris? – plays a large role. Furthermore , the topography – is the land level, sloping, or hilly? – can dramatically raise labor demands. Finally, authorizations and removal fees for debris inflate the ultimate price, which could easily push costs beyond that initial range.

Choosing the Appropriate Tools: Skid Steer vs. Mini Excavator for Brush Removal
When embarking a site preparation project, choosing the correct equipment is essential. Numerous property owners confront the decision of picking between a skid steer and a compact excavator. Loaders shine at handling debris, smoothing ground, and basic tasks requiring shoving power, often with accessories like scoops and rakes. Conversely, a mini excavator furnishes superior excavating capabilities for root stumps, handling heavy brush, and making detailed earthworks.
